Songs that were on top of the charts in the USA and the United Kingdom on August 1, 2002:

  • United States: "Hot In Herre" by Nelly
  • United Kingdom: "Anyone Of Us" by Gareth Gates

The Billboard Hot 100 on August 1, 2002

These were the top five songs on the Billboard Hot 100 chart:

  • Hot In Herre - Nelly
  • Without Me - Eminem
  • Complicated - Avril Lavigne
  • Hero - Chad Kroeger Featuring Josey Scott
  • I Need A Girl (Part Two) - P. Diddy & Ginuwine Featuring Loon, Mario Winans & Tammy Ruggeri

The date is August 1, 2002, and it's a Thursday. Anyone born today will have the star sign Leo. The summer of 2002 is in full swing. The weather is warm, and the evenings are brighter than usual. Most schools and colleges are now finished until August or September.

In America, the song "Hot In Herre" by Nelly is at the top of the singles charts, while "Anyone Of Us" by Gareth Gates is the number-one song in the UK. George W. Bush Jnr. is the President of the United States, and the movie Goldmember is at the top of the box office. Tony Blair is the Prime Minister of the United Kingdom.

On television, people are watching popular shows such as "Charmed", "Becker", "Smallville", and "The Wire". Meanwhile, the Nokia 3310 is one of the most popular cellphones on the market at the moment. Stores across the world are currently selling a wide range of custom covers for the phone. In technology news, more and more people are beginning to gain access to the Internet. Internet speeds are increasing and MP3 sharing is beginning to threaten the existence of music stores.

People are using a software program called LimeWire to share music, software, and videos. Unfortunately, it is also a haven for computer viruses. It's 2002, so the music charts are being dominated by the likes of Ashanti, Nickelback, Nelly, Eminem, Usher, Blu Cantrell, The Calling, Linkin Park and Jennifer Lopez. A rock music genre called "Emo" is beginning to become more and more mainstream.

If you were to travel back to this day, notable figures such as Jam Master Jay, Lana Clarkson, Curt Hennig, and Fred Rogers would all still be alive. People are playing video games such as "RuneScape", "Twisted Metal: Black", "Tony Hawk's Pro Skater 3", and "Ace Combat 04: Shattered Skies". Kids and teenagers are watching TV shows such as "The Simpsons", "As Told by Ginger", "Grounded for Life", and "Jimmy Neutron".

Children are playing with toys such as Fisher Price Chatter Phone, HitClips audio player, Chicken Dance Elmo, and Beyblades (spinning top toys).

    Bennifer

    In July of 2002, Jennifer Lopez and Ben Affleck began dating. It wasn't long until the tabloids started to refer to the new couple as "Bennifer". The previous month, Lopez and her husband Chris Judd had split up after less than a year of marriage.

    Internet usage increases dramatically

    From about 2002 onward, Internet usage increased dramatically across the world. Faster broadband networks were being rolled out, allowing users to download and stream their favorite music and videos. It was around this time that social networks became a thing.
  • The Internet begins to hurt music stores.

    The Internet begins to hurt music stores

    MP3 sharing on the Internet became extremely common in the early-to-mid 2000s. MP3 players were taking over, and portable CD players such as the "Discman" were being phased out. As downloads surged, it became increasingly obvious that most music stores would not survive the onslaught of the new digital age.

Events

What happened around this time?

News stories, pop culture trends, and other events that happened around August 1, 2002.

  • July 3, 2002: Men in Black II (2002) is released.
  • July 4, 2002: Actress Julia Roberts marries cameraman Daniel Moder.
  • July 8, 2002: English pop singer Gareth Gates releases the song "Anyone of Us (Stupid Mistake)".
  • July 9, 2002: American actor Rod Steiger dies at the age of 77 following complications from surgery for a gall bladder tumor.
  • July 12, 2002: Road to Perdition (2002) is released.
  • July 16, 2002: Eminem releases his single "Cleanin' Out My Closet".
  • July 17, 2002: Angelina Jolie files for divorce from husband Billy Bob Thornton.
  • July 20, 2002: The animated series "The Adventures of Jimmy Neutron, Boy Genius" debuts on Nickelodeon.
  • July 21, 2002: WorldCom files for Chapter 11 bankruptcy protection.
  • July 22, 2002: Soccer: Rio Ferdinand joins Manchester United.
  • July 25, 2002: Wrestling: Rey Mysterio makes his first WWE appearance.
  • July 26, 2002:
    • Austin Powers in Goldmember (2002) is released.
    • Kate Lawler wins the 3rd season of the reality TV series "Big Brother" (UK).
    • Jennifer Lopez files for divorce from Chris Judd.
  • July 27, 2002: 77 people are killed after a fighter jet crashes during an air show in Lviv, Ukraine.
  • July 28, 2002: 9 coal miners are freed from a flooded mine in Pennsylvania.
  • July 29, 2002: American funk rock band N*E*R*D release their single "Rock Star".
  • This date: August 1, 2002
  • August 2, 2002: Signs (2002) is released.
  • August 4, 2002: Jessica Chapman and Holly Wells go missing in Soham, England.
  • August 6, 2002: Cam'ron releases the song "Hey Ma".
  • August 10, 2002: Actor Nicolas Cage and Lisa Marie Presley are married in Hawaii.
  • August 12, 2002: British girl group Sugababes release their single "Round Round".
  • August 17, 2002:
    • Soham murders: Ian Huntley is arrested on suspicion of abduction and murder.
    • Soham murders: The bodies of Jessica Chapman and Holly Wells are discovered.
  • August 20, 2002: Soham murders: Ian Huntley is formally charged with two counts of murder.
  • August 28, 2002: The game "Mafia: The City of Lost Heaven" is released.
  • August 29, 2002: "Without Me" by Eminem wins Video of the Year at the 2002 MTV Video Music Awards.
